Output 11d27959bc0ce837f6a1d2e5c9ca6a7fb345d5c18b58c7b54937ea1aa9ebe716:13

value
4389736400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ddd7efd21767d1ddc0fbbd9147f7b7c19ab6e5c OP_EQUAL
address
32xL3rRRCQhDuXbzrjPLddwPNpdwz2Fkg4
transaction
11d27959bc0ce837f6a1d2e5c9ca6a7fb345d5c18b58c7b54937ea1aa9ebe716
spent
true